insErTinG bATTEriEs

The device needs two type

AA, 1.5 V batteries

to operate.

1. Slide the battery compartment lid on the side

off the device.

2. Insert 2 batteries as shown. Observe correct

polarity (+/-).

3. Slide the lid back into place.

froThinG MiLk

Clean the foaming spiral before the first use as

described in the section “Cleaning”.

Use a suitable container to foam milk, if possi-

ble a tall container or jug, as splashes cannot

always be avoided. Fill the container max. up

to 1/3. Do not use containers with a sensitive

surface. Avoid touching the walls of the contai-

ner with the foaming spiral, as this might cause

scratches. Small foaming jugs made of highgra-

de steel are ideal.
1. Pour milk into a suitable container.
WArninG – risk of scalding

• To avoid splashes: first lower the spiral into

the liquid, before switching the device on.

Switch the device off first, before removing

the spiral from the liquid.
2. Lower the spiral of the milk frother into the

milk and press the bottom black button.

The switch clicks into place and can be re-

leased during use.
3. Move the frother to and fro in the container

so that air is mixed with the milk.
4. Press the black button once more to switch

the device off.
5. Pour the foamed milk onto your cappuccino

and sprinkle a little sugar or cocoa powder

on top.

Your cappuccino is ready.
Tip: For best results we recommend using fresh

milk which can be foamed in either a cold or

hot condition. However, the milk should not

come to a boil. This will give it an unpleasant

taste and causes skin to form on its surface.

CLEAninG

Dip the mixing coil into hot, dishwater and

switch it on for a few seconds. Afterwards rinse

it and switch the appliance on again for drying

the mixing coil. Do not bend the mixing leg.

Wipe the handle with a damp cloth. Handle

and battery housing may not be dipped into

water. Please do not clean the appliance

in the dishwasher.
